The Complete Guide to Comprehensive API Documentation Overview

In the world of modern software development, APIs act as the bridge between applications, enabling them to communicate, share data, and perform tasks in ways that were once unimaginable. However, the effectiveness of an API is only as good as its documentation. A comprehensive API documentation overview provides developers with the roadmap they need to implement, test, and scale the functionality of an API successfully. Without clear documentation, even the most powerful APIs risk being underutilized or misused. In this guide, we will explore why detailed API documentation is essential, what components make it effective, and how businesses can leverage it to streamline integration and innovation.

Why Comprehensive Documentation Matters

Comprehensive API documentation is not just a helpful add-on; it is the backbone of an API’s usability. Developers often rely on documentation as their first point of contact with an API, and the quality of this material can determine whether they adopt the service or abandon it. Detailed documentation provides clarity, minimizes trial and error, and reduces the need for constant support inquiries. It ensures that both experienced developers and newcomers can integrate the API efficiently. Moreover, from a business perspective, well-crafted documentation enhances customer satisfaction, reduces onboarding time, and builds trust in the reliability of the product.

Key Elements of Strong API Documentation

A comprehensive API documentation overview should include several critical elements that serve different purposes for developers. First, it should contain a clear introduction that explains what the API does, its intended use cases, and the problems it solves. Next, it should provide authentication details, explaining how developers can securely connect to the API. Endpoint explanations are another essential component, offering descriptions of available requests, parameters, and expected responses. Error codes and troubleshooting guides must also be included to save developers time when things go wrong. Finally, code examples written in different programming languages help make the documentation more accessible by showing real-world applications.

Enhancing Developer Experience

The ultimate goal of API documentation is to create an excellent developer experience. Developers should not feel lost when using an API; instead, they should feel empowered and supported by the resources provided. A comprehensive API documentation overview makes this possible by organizing information logically and using clear, concise language. By including both beginner-friendly guides and advanced reference material, the documentation can cater to a wide audience. Furthermore, interactive documentation, where developers can test endpoints directly within the documentation, is increasingly popular because it reduces guesswork and encourages hands-on experimentation. When the developer experience is prioritized, adoption rates increase, and businesses benefit from stronger ecosystems built around their APIs.

The Role of Consistency and Accuracy

Consistency is an often-overlooked but crucial aspect of comprehensive API documentation. Inconsistent naming conventions, vague parameter explanations, or incomplete sections can frustrate developers and lead to errors during implementation. By maintaining a consistent structure and tone across the documentation, businesses can ensure that developers quickly understand and trust the content. Accuracy is equally important; outdated or incorrect information can cause significant setbacks. Regular updates to documentation ensure that as the API evolves, users always have access to the most current details. This reliability fosters confidence and encourages developers to invest time and effort into building with the API.

Security Considerations in Documentation

Security is a top concern in today’s digital environment, and API documentation must address it thoroughly. A comprehensive API documentation overview should provide explicit details about authentication protocols, rate limits, and recommended best practices for keeping data safe. For instance, explaining the use of API keys, OAuth tokens, or IP whitelisting gives developers the tools they need to secure their integrations effectively. Additionally, highlighting common security pitfalls and offering solutions ensures that developers are not only aware of risks but also equipped to mitigate them. By embedding security education into documentation, businesses protect both their users and themselves from vulnerabilities.

Supporting Compliance and Industry Standards

In many industries, compliance with regulations and standards is non-negotiable. A comprehensive API documentation overview can play an important role in helping businesses meet these requirements. For example, APIs used in finance or healthcare may need to comply with GDPR, HIPAA, or PCI DSS standards. Clear documentation that explains how the API supports these standards helps developers integrate it without running afoul of regulatory bodies. Additionally, compliance-related guidance reassures businesses that the API provider is committed to operating responsibly, which can be a strong differentiator in competitive markets.

Accelerating Integration and Time-to-Market

Speed is often critical in software development, and API documentation plays a direct role in reducing integration time. A clear, detailed, and well-structured documentation overview eliminates guesswork and allows developers to quickly understand how to connect systems, pass data, and trigger functionality. By accelerating integration, businesses can bring products to market faster, respond to customer needs more quickly, and maintain a competitive edge. This advantage is particularly vital in fast-moving industries like fintech, e-commerce, and SaaS, where delays in integration can mean lost opportunities.

Documentation as a Marketing Tool

Interestingly, comprehensive API documentation also doubles as a powerful marketing tool. When potential customers evaluate different API providers, the quality of the documentation is often one of the deciding factors. Well-presented documentation reflects professionalism, attention to detail, and commitment to customer success. It signals that the provider values developer experience and is invested in long-term partnerships. Furthermore, public documentation can attract organic search traffic, as developers frequently search for solutions to specific problems. By creating detailed, SEO-friendly API documentation, businesses can increase visibility and attract new users without additional marketing spend.

Future of API Documentation

As technology evolves, the expectations around API documentation are also changing. The future of comprehensive API documentation will likely include greater interactivity, with sandbox environments, AI-driven assistance, and real-time updates integrated directly into the documentation interface. Natural language search functions may allow developers to ask questions conversationally and receive tailored answers instantly. Additionally, as APIs become more interconnected, documentation will need to provide context not just for individual endpoints but also for entire workflows that span multiple systems. Businesses that stay ahead of these trends by continuously innovating in their documentation will stand out and attract loyal developer communities.

Conclusion

A comprehensive API documentation overview is far more than a technical manual—it is the foundation of successful API adoption and integration. By prioritizing clarity, accuracy, and usability, businesses can empower developers to leverage their APIs effectively, reduce support burdens, and accelerate growth. Strong documentation also enhances security, supports compliance, and positions the API provider as a trusted partner. In an increasingly interconnected digital world, the businesses that invest in creating and maintaining outstanding API documentation will enjoy not only stronger adoption rates but also long-term customer loyalty. Ultimately, great documentation transforms APIs from simple tools into engines of innovation and collaboration.